You example (attacking a person because he hurt your mother's feelings) isn't an example of "hate" necessarily. Plus, hate crimes refer to "hate" (more likely prejudice) on a grand scale (like racism or homophobia). A person who hates a particular individual because that individual hurt his mother's feelings isn't half as dangerous as a person who hates entire groups of people for irrational and prejudiced reasons.
As for the sports thing, well that's like the whole console war we got going on over here. It's a form of primitive tribal manifestations (the fans are like members of the tribe, the game is like war, winning the game is like winning the war, when the team you support wins the war the feeling is comparable to that of when tribes would win a war in the past, fans put on clothes with certain colors and paint their bodies sometime - war pain - etc.). This has little to do with the prejudices of racism or homophobia, or sexism.
